De-code Binary to ASCII Conversion Easily
Binary code, here with its simple sequences, can be a daunting puzzle. But don't fear! Converting it to readable ASCII is actually straightforward. We'll guide you through the steps, breaking down each piece of binary into its corresponding ASCII symbol. With a little practice, you'll be switching binary to text in no time!
- Start with a basic example: the binary number 01000001.
- This sequence corresponds directly to the ASCII code for the letter 'A'.
- Keep this pattern and you can decode any binary message.

Decoding JSON in Python: The Full Form Explained
JSON, which stands for JavaScript Object Notation, is a lightweight and ubiquitous data-interchange format. It's widely utilized across the web for transmitting information between servers and applications. In Python, you can effortlessly analyze JSON data using its built-in modules. The `json` module offers versatile functions to encode Python objects into JSON strings and vice versa. To decode a JSON string in Python, you can employ the `json.loads()` function.
Let's delve into a practical example: suppose you have a JSON string representing a person's information:
`"name": "Alice", "age": 30, "city": "New York"`. To extract this data in Python, you would use the following code:
import jsonjson_data = '"name": "Alice", "age": 30, "city": "New York"'
python_dict = json.loads(json_data)
print(python_dict["name"]) # Output: Alice
print(python_dict["age"]) # Output: 30
print(python_dict["city"]) # Output: New York
In essence, `json.loads()` converts the JSON string into a Python dictionary, enabling you to access its data as if it were a native Python object.
